A compelling argument can be made that Merle Haggard has been the most important country artist to emerge since the 1950s (Willie Nelson and Waylon Jennings are his only true competition), and HAG: THE BEST OF MERLE HAGGARD supports that argument with 26 incontrovertible pieces of evidence. The only single-disc compilation to span the whole of Haggard's career (encompassing all of his many label changes), HAG contains the lion's share of the country legend's greatest hits, including "Branded Man," "Mama Tried," and "Okie from Muskogee," alongside duets with Johnny Cash and Willie Nelson. Haggard's voice and picking come through like reliable old friends, but it is his spectacular songwriting that really shines. The 2006 reissue features beautifully remastered sound. Originally released in 1972, THE BEST OF THE BEST includes 11 of Haggard's then-recent hits. These are the songs that earned him the nickname "the working man's poet."
